Title: Design optimization of a mirror used in METIS, by combining FEM-, state space- and optical analysis


About this event

For infra-red astronomical observations, one of METIS’s subsystems (the chopper) must cancel out background IR radiation. This is done by recording background radiation in ‘empty’ space and subtracting that from the area of interest (chopping). Chopping is highly dynamic (8 mrad stroke in <10 ms). Acceleration of the chopper’s mirror and strain in its elastic elements lead to deformations of the optical surface. A novel method (FEM-analysis of mode shapes, combined with state-space modelling, and optical analysis) is used to analyze the effect these disturbance forces have on the optical train, and to drive design decisions of key elements the design of the chopper.
